Bayern Munich and England striker Harry Kane has become the first English player to win Germany’s Footballer of the Year award, adding another major honour to his impressive spell in Germany. Kane was presented with the prestigious award at the Allianz Arena ahead of Bayern Munich’s Bundesliga opener. The striker described the recognition as a special moment, particularly after receiving it in front of the club’s supporters.Sharing his reaction on social media, Kane wrote: “An honour to become the first English player to win Germany’s Footballer of the Year award. A special feeling to receive it at the Allianz in front of our incredible fans. Great to collect it alongside the gaffer and Giulia Gwinn – congratulations to you both!” England star on X.He also congratulated Bayern coach Vincent Kompany and Giulia Gwinn, who were named Coach of the Year and Women’s Footballer of the Year respectively.

Kane beats teammate Olise

Kane was voted the winner by members of the Association of German Sports Journalists (VDS), collecting 272 of 659 votes. Bayern teammate Michael Olise finished second with 203 votes, while Kane succeeds Florian Wirtz, who won the award in 2025. The honour recognises Kane’s outstanding 2025-26 campaign, during which he scored a remarkable 36 Bundesliga goals.The Germany Footballer of the Year prize is Kane’s latest individual achievement. Earlier in the week, he was awarded the European Golden Shoe after finishing as Europe’s leading scorer during the 2025-26 season. He also celebrated team success with Bayern Munich, who defeated Borussia Dortmund 2-1 in the 2026 Franz Beckenbauer Supercup on Saturday.Although Kane did not get on the scoresheet in the Supercup, his remarkable run of individual honours continued with his historic recognition in Germany.
